Frequently asked questions about Ward Es East
How many students attend Ward Es East?
Ward Es East has 165 students enrolled. It is an elementary school in Colbert, OK. CCD year-over-year: 177 (2022-23) → 169 (2023-24), nearly flat (-8).
What is the student-teacher ratio at Ward Es East?
The student-teacher ratio at Ward Es East is 15:1, which is 7% lower than the Oklahoma average of 16.1:1 and 4%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Ward Es East?
The largest demographic group at Ward Es East is White at 57.6% of enrollment, in Colbert, OK.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 61.2/100.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Ward Es East?
Ward Es East has a Resource Investment Index of 46/100 (typical re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).
